Without your support this important campaign would not have come this far. The importance of what Wicklesham Quarry represents extends far beyond Faringdon. Let me share what my barrister, Pavlos Eleftheriadis of FTB Chambers thinks about our fight to protect Wicklesham Quarry: "This case raises important issues regarding Neighbourhood Plans and environmental justice. Can a Neighbourhood Plan ignore the strategic policies of a Local Plan? What is the legal status of restoration conditions for mineral workings? How should Biodiversity Action Plans influence planning policy? These are important questions that the court will be asked to decide."
